Overwhelmingly unimpressed. Bar staff understaffed so when we sat down at a half-full bar, it was crystal clear that our presence was an inconvenience. Not knowing what the brews were like, we wanted to try a couple brews, but as soon as the words, “I don’t know..” left my mouth the server blew us off and helped three other couples. As a result, once we did order, our food took more than 30 minutes, the fries were luke warm, the medium-rare burger was well done, plus a number of other obvious short-sighted service points. The tip absolutely reflected the attention we received. We won’t be back.
We came here based on other reviews. Nice restaurant with great soups! Tonight’s soup is bacon cheeseburger. That sounds interesting! We tried it and it was so good and thick, creamy and seasoned just right! I’m going to try to make it at home now! It was that tasty!
We shared the huckleberry bbq brisket burger with tots. The burger was cooked medium as we requested. It was juicy with a lot of flavor. We did order the toffee pudding cake. It was unique and not offered at other places. A very rich dessert with a distinct molasses flavor with caramel. I don’t think a kid would like it. It could be shared between 3 and 4 people after eating a meal. Of course prices of items will change..especially these days.
